Kid Icarus:
Map of the Saints
Oh Kid Icarus, eh? I LOVED that game growing up. That game was so freaking RULESOME! This album is going to be so freaking cool. Maybe its an album homage of the game! Or maybe its the story of that game! Or maybe its the music of that game! That would rule. Oh. Its not. Okay, well, its still a cool name. These guys are gonna rule, because anyone whod name their band Kid Icarus has got to be cool. Cause people who play video games are always cool! Okay not always cool. But smart! Definitely smart! (looks at the GameFAQs Forums) Well maybe not smart Bah! Whatever! This album has potential based solely on its name. Lets give it a listen. Well this is cool. Sounds like an airplane taking off, only with guitars! Ive heard it before, but every album Ive heard that on has rocked! Must be a big buildup to the kicking of some asses! Yeah! This is gone rule! Oh. Songs over. Hmmm. Hmmmmmmmmm. Okay, I see what theyre going for. Reminds me of Sonic Youth. I see. Wait a minute. When did we go acoustic? Sounds like something else Ive heard. Not Sonic Youth taking off in an airplane though. Sounds like hmmm. Oh well, that songs over. Wait a minute. Didnt this song just play? (checks track, name) oh. Same song. Why the uncomfortably long pause there? Why are they repeating the same lines again? Why did they just play the same two minutes of song over again WITHIN THE SAME TRACK?! New song now. Oh look, the airplanes back. Wait, now Sonic Youth IS on the airplane. This must be turbulence. What are they, in space all the sudden? Reminds me of 2001: A SPACE ODYSSEEEEEEEY (echo effect). Trippy. Trip-like. Airplaney, too! What is this one? Vocal harmonies? Sounds like its got some pote DEAR GOD! Stop singing! Oh lord, my ears. Oh no please someone tell him he has no pitch. Doesnt this guy have any friends or loved ones to protect him from believing he can sing well? Reminds me of that WB Superstar show maybe this IS that. Oh man, that was mean. What an asshole you are, Jon. Heh. Well, that songs over. More of that. I wonder when the airplane will land oh, this song has airplane in the lyrics. Those lines didnt rhyme sigh Note to self: Please do NOT go into a review with any expectations of a band. Especially unfair expectations. But most especially, reasonable expectations. Also, NO expectations whatsoever. Kid Icarus Maps of the Saints: More of the same, done better elsewhere.
